RESPX is a simple, yet powerful, utility for mocking out the HTTPX, and HTTP Core , libraries.
Start by patching HTTPX, using
respx.mock, then add request
routes to mock
responses.
import httpx import respx from httpx import Response @respx.mock def test_example(): my_route = respx.get("https://example.org/").mock(return_value=Response(204)) response = httpx.get("https://example.org/") assert my_route.called assert response.status_code == 204

For a neater pytest experience, RESPX includes a respx_mock fixture for easy
HTTPX mocking, along with an optional respx marker to fine-tune the mock
settings.
import httpx import pytest def test_default(respx_mock): respx_mock.get("https://foo.bar/").mock(return_value=httpx.Response(204)) response = httpx.get("https://foo.bar/") assert response.status_code == 204 @pytest.mark.respx(base_url="https://foo.bar") def test_with_marker(respx_mock): respx_mock.get("/baz/").mock(return_value=httpx.Response(204)) response = httpx.get("https://foo.bar/baz/") assert response.status_code == 204
Install with pip:
$ pip install respxRequires Python 3.8+ and HTTPX 0.25+. See Changelog for older HTTPX compatibility.
